I Am President Tinubu’s Only Anointed Candidate, APC Flagbearer Oyebamiji Declares

The Managing Director and Chief Executive Officer of the National Inland Waterways Authority (NIWA), Asiwaju Munirudeen Bola Oyebamiji, has declared that he remains the sole anointed governorship candidate of President Bola Tinubu for the upcoming August 2026 Osun State gubernatorial election.

Oyebamiji made the statement to clear the air regarding internal party dynamics and multi-factional maneuvers within the Osun State chapter of the All Progressives Congress (APC).

He insisted that his political ambition is fully backed by the presidency, anchoring his claim on his long-standing track record of loyalty to the progressive fold and his administrative performance both at the state and federal levels.

The NIWA boss, who previously served as the Commissioner for Finance in Osun State under the administrations of Rauf Aregbesola and Gboyega Oyetola, emerged as the APC’s official flagbearer following a consensus arrangement and affirmation primary overseen by the party’s national leadership. Oyebamiji emphasized that his selection was a product of strategic alignment to reclaim the state for the APC, dismissing speculations of any division within the presidency regarding support for his candidature.

While rallying party faithful and stakeholders to close ranks ahead of the main election, Oyebamiji reiterated that his primary focus is to unite all aggrieved blocks within the Osun APC. He maintained that the collective goal of the party must remain supreme to ensure a successful campaign against the ruling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) in the state, positioning himself as the unifying figure trusted by the national leadership to deliver victory at the polls.
